Re:Wrong monthly/yearly rainfall

Post by sevenless »

"all points y value undefined" signifies that you need to recompute your weather data.

Maintenance page > Recompute, and then wait for a bit while it does its data crunching, then try again.

Re:Wrong monthly/yearly rainfall

Post by admin »

you should be able to reach the meteohub web interface on backup port 7777. switch back http port settings to 80 as a first step.

There is usually no need to change http-port settings in Meteohub itself. When you need access from the outside on different ports, let that do your router by it's forwarding rules.
